First of all congrats on starting your journey into the babymax crew! Second, while on the hunt for your truck, be on the lookout for 2 things. #1 try to find one with the 3.73 rear gears, RPO code GT4. You have to scan the QR code in these but most dealers will get you a good pic so you can do it on your phone and your phone will decipher it. My buddy and I have almost the exact same truck/camper setup except mine has the 3.73 and his has the 3.23. Mine outperforms his no questions asked in 9/10 scenarios. #2 if you don’t want Z71 for other reasons, don’t be afraid to try to find one that has the max trailering package. The rear suspension of the Z71 is pretty trash for towing anywhere near towing capacity and the non-Z71 is much better at fighting squat. I had to install RAS and am about to replace the Rancho shocks with Bilatein 5100s to have it perform better. Just my $.02. Good luck!!
